Tender Overview

Urban Utilities is responsible for receiving, assessing and approving applications for the connection, disconnection and alteration to the water and sewerage networks within the Brisbane, Ipswich, Lockyer valley, Scenic Rim and Somerset local government areas. To assist in these functions, Urban Utilities has established a Certification Scheme to provide efficient, quality and cost-effective design and construction certification services.

The Certification Scheme provides a mechanism for customers to engage ‘third-party’ engineering consultants approved by Urban Utilities (Endorsed Consultants) to certify that the design and construction of Property Service Infrastructure and Network Infrastructure classified by Urban Utilities as ‘minor works’ complies with Water Approval Conditions and the SEQ Water Supply and Sewerage Design and Construction Code (SEQ Code). 

Urban Utilities is undertaking a review of the current register of Endorsed Consultants and invites engineering consultants with the capability, qualifications and experience needed to carry out the certification services to apply for registration.

The new register of Endorsed Consultants to be established as a result of this EOI Process will replace the existing register of endorsed consultants. Those endorsed consultants, who are presently on the register will, therefore, need to re-apply if they wish to remain on the register.
